    Does Earls provide BTU ratings for their Temp A Cure oil coolers? If not, how can I calculate what size cooler I need. I know I need a cooler with a Max BTU rating of 60,000 BTU/hr. & prefer to purchase an Earls product.

    Asked by: TimJ
    Hello, Here is all the Earl's tech could provide..Manufactured in the U.S.A. using the latest vacuum brazing technology. Internal turbulator plates increase both thermal efficiency and mechanical strength resulting in the most efficient, smallest practical package. Manufactured in Aluminum for the fastest possible heat transfer. Inlet and outlet fittings O-ring female bosses -10 AN port ( 7/8-14) Designed for wide ranges of oils and oil flows with air speeds encountered in motorsports and highway use. Available in three widths, Narrow, Wide , Extra Wide. Every cooler is pressure checked to 175 psi. Engineering samples are burst tested to 350 psi. ........... they offered a BTU rating on this @ 74,000 Thank you,
